An EB-5 visa is taken into consideration Rural if the investment task is in a location with a populace much less than
20,000 and not within a Metropolitan Statistical Area(MSA )or surrounding to an MSA. An investment certifies as a High Unemployment job if it is in an area where the unemployment price is at least 150 %of the nationwide typical unemployment price. For shorter-term company requirements, the B-1 Organization visa supplies another opportunity. This visa enables international nationals to enter the U.S. temporarily for organization objectives such as meetings, arrangements, or important source contract discussions, though it does not permit employment.
